+ } else if (e.name === 'NotAllowedError'){
+ /* Firefox on Fedora/Wayland: NotAllowedError fires WITHOUT
+ * showing a permission prompt even when site permission is
+ * unset/removed (fox 2026-06-08 ticket 0002). That signature
+ * is firefox-canonical for "no prompt fired" — and one known
+ * cause is the constraints object: certain hardware + driver
+ * combos make Firefox reject {width/height/aspectRatio/frameRate}
+ * ideals as if they were a permission denial.
+ *
+ * Retry once with bare {video:true}. If THAT works, the
+ * elaborate constraints were the culprit. If THAT also fires
+ * NotAllowedError, it's a real permission denial — surface
+ * the recovery notice. */
+ logLine('', 'camera open retry: NotAllowedError → bare {video:true}');
+ try {
+ stream = await navigator.mediaDevices.getUserMedia({ video: true, audio: false });
+ logLine('', 'camera open recovered with bare {video:true} — firefox constraint misclassification');
+ } catch(e2){
+ logLine('err','camera open retry failed: '+(e2.name||'Error')+' — '+e2.message);
+ if (e2.name === 'NotAllowedError'){
+ const ua = navigator.userAgent || '';
+ const ff = /Firefox\//.test(ua);
+ showNotice(
+ ff
+ ? 'Camera blocked by your browser. Click the lock icon in the URL bar → "Connection secure" → "More information" → Permissions, then change "Use the camera" to Allow. Reload and try again.'
+ : 'Camera blocked. Click the lock or camera icon in the URL bar and allow camera access for this site, then try again.',
+ 'warn'
+ );
+ }
+ fsm.send('FAILED', { error: e2.message }); fsm.send('DONE'); return;
+ }
